EU and UK customers
If you're a consumer in the EU or UK, you normally have a 14-day right of withdrawal for digital purchases. For digital content delivered immediately, that right can end once download begins, because by choosing to download right away you may be asked to consent to immediate performance and to acknowledge that you lose the statutory withdrawal right. To keep things simple and fair, we don't rely on that: our 14-day money-back policy above applies to you regardless. Nothing here limits any rights you have under applicable consumer-protection law.
